Monday, September 16, 2024 The global railway propulsion system market was valued at approximately $9.9 billion in 2022 and is projected to grow to $15.1 billion by 2032, with a compound annual growth rate (CAGR) of 4.

5% from 2023 to 2032. This expansion is primarily fueled by increased budget allocations for railway development projects, a growing reliance on public transport to alleviate traffic congestion, rising demand for safety and regulatory compliance in rail systems, and the need to enhance both passenger and freight capacities. Emerging economies, particularly in Asia, such as India and Japan, are investing heavily in modernizing their railway infrastructure.



These investments are driven by the allocation of higher budgets for railway development. For instance, India has announced plans to install Automatic Train Protection (ATP) systems on 300 to 400 Vande Bharat trains as part of its 2023-24 budget. In addition, the Indian government earmarked around $15.

06 billion for railway development with a total capital outlay of $30.80 billion for the fiscal year 2021-2022, reflecting a 33% increase in capital expenditure compared to the previous year. Similarly, substantial investments in advanced propulsion technologies and railway infrastructure improvements are expected to propel market growth.

In June 2022, the European Union (EU) committed $5.7 billion to fund 135 transport infrastructure projects across Europe, further highlighting the significance of infrastructure upgrades in driving the global railway propulsion system market. Additionally, the rising global population has led to an increase in the use of private vehicles, exacerbating traffic congestion.

As a result, more individuals are turning to public transportation, which offers a more efficient, comfortable, and cost-effective alternative. Factors such as heightened concerns about vehicle emissions, the need for enhanced safety, and the demand for faster transportation solutions have significantly boosted the preference for rail travel. Across the globe, various railway organizations are actively working on expanding and upgrading rail networks, investing heavily in high-speed train technology to accommodate the increasing demand for public transportation.

For example, in September 2022, British Columbia committed $300,000 to a high-speed rail study, aiming to connect key cities in the Pacific Northwest through the Ultra-High-Speed Ground Transportation Project, linking Vancouver, Seattle, and Portland. Similarly, in July 2021, the U.S.

Department of Transportation (USDOT) and the State of California allocated approximately $928.9 million in federal grants to advance California’s High-Speed Rail initiative..
